## Step 4: Enable the reconciliation job

The Tidewell inventory reconciliation job compares warehouse counts against ledger entries every night and writes discrepancies to the review queue. New team members: do not run it manually in production; use the staging trigger first and check the discrepancy report. Once the schema migration from Step 3 is confirmed, flip the job to the new tables. It reads the following configuration at startup, shown here for reference.

config for kawif-hahig:
zorix:
  log_level: error
  metrics_host: metrics.zorix.lumiclabs.internal
  pool_size: 16

Plugin authors should develop exclusively against sandbox, which receives synthetic crash payloads every fifteen minutes and tolerates schema experiments. Staging mirrors production topology but retains data for only seven days, so do not rely on it for longitudinal testing. Ingest endpoints, symbolication workers, and the dedup layer are versioned together per environment. For sandbox integration testing, your plugin should be configured with the following values:

settings of fafog-haduf:
ZORIX_PIN=4648
ZORIX_METRICS_HOST=metrics.zorix.paliqsys.corp
ZORIX_LOG_LEVEL=info
ZORIX_TENANT=druix

Refactor work on the Millgate ORM layer stays behind the legacy-compat flag. If migrations fail in staging, stop; do not patch forward. Escalate to the data platform rotation with the failing migration ID and schema diff. Contractors may not merge to the mapping core unaffected. For escalation routing questions, contact the refactor lead.

escalation mailbox, kadup-fajof: ulador@qirvanlabs.corp

Digest scheduling on Pellbridge runs via POST /v2/digests with a cron expression and recipient group. Batches over 5,000 messages are split automatically; retries back off over 15 minutes. On-call: if a digest stalls, re-trigger with force=true. All calls to the internal scheduler must include the key printed below.

gateway credential: kto23_LX9A4ys6i4nzHtpOLNLodKK